Most production boats in the 35' - 45' range are sold into charter fleets - I'd guess somewhere between 50% and 80% of new boats in this category.

If those are the kind of boats you're looking at then it's about maximising the number of berths they can cram in, and probably also having a swim platform at the rear.

If you read something like Kretschmer's Flirting with Mermaids or Yacht Design According To
Perry
, it seems like 20 years ago¹ people bought cruising sailboats with the dream of crossing oceans on them.

Realistically, most boats sold today are sold into charter or used mostly at weekends; it's that kind of coastal cruising that modern designs are best suited for.

 

¹ I suspect it's really a case that 40 years ago, and even as late as 20 years ago, people still did this, but those books are on my shelves and spring to mind.
